Governor Ademola Adeleke of Osun State has resigned his membership of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P).

Adeleke made this known in a letter dated November 4, addressed to the chairman of the party in Sagba Abogunde, Ward 2, Ede North Local Government Area of the state.

In the letter made available to newsmen in the early hours of Tuesday in Osogbo, Adeleke cited persistent leadership turmoil at the party’s national level as the reason for his resignation.

The letter reads: “Due to the current crisis of the national leadership of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), I hereby resign my membership of the party with immediate effect.

” I thank the PDP for the opportunities given to me for my elections as a Senator (Representative, Osun West) and as Governor of Osun State under the Peoples Democratic Party.”

Although the governor did not mention the party he would be defecting to in the letter, it was learnt that Adeleke might be defecting to the Accord Party in the coming days.

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has fixed August 8, 2026, for the governorship election in the state.
